A way to uninstall Windows 8 Manager from your system

This info is about Windows 8 Manager for Windows. Here you can find details on how to uninstall it from your PC. It is written by Yamicsoft. You can read more on Yamicsoft or check for application updates here. You can get more details about Windows 8 Manager at . Usually the Windows 8 Manager application is installed in the C:\Program Files\Yamicsoft\Windows 8 Manager directory, depending on the user's option during setup. The full command line for uninstalling Windows 8 Manager is MsiExec.exe /I{81B753C5-097A-4FE0-B6EC-FBE7C977481A}. Keep in mind that if you will type this command in Start / Run Note you might get a notification for admin rights. Windows8Manager.exe is the programs's main file and it takes close to 1.83 MB (1917952 bytes) on disk.

The executable files below are part of Windows 8 Manager. They take about 16.02 MB (16801104 bytes) on disk.
